New Business Software

  • Subscribe to our RSS feed.
  • Twitter
  • StumbleUpon
  • Reddit
  • Facebook
  • Digg

Thursday, 19 July 2007

Our Directory is Your Directory

Posted on 16:13 by Unknown
Posted by Bob Purvy & Robert Escorcio, Google Engineers

From the very beginning, we've recognized that, in order for customers to get the most out of Google Apps, they will want to enjoy the Apps but not rip out their infrastructure to do so. As a result, we've tried to have open APIs to our applications and to Google Apps administration. One key area is corporate directories, and most companies already manage their users through their LDAP or equivalent directory service.

To give customers a jump start in migrating and synchronizing users from their LDAP directory, we've created an LDAP synchronization tool that we are releasing on code.google.com. However, while many companies have an LDAP directory, they often use it in different ways. Because of this, we've decided to release this into open source, so many developers can improve and adapt the tool to their own needs. The tool is written in Python, and uses the Google Apps User Provisioning API to create, delete, and suspend users.

Best of all, we eat our own dogfood, and we've used this tool here at Google to synchronize with our own LDAP directory. We run our own business on Google Apps, and we want other companies to benefit from this effort.

We hope to see a thousands flowers bloom, and look forward to other developers adding to and morphing the tool for their own needs. You can find the project at: http://code.google.com/p/google-apps-for-your-domain-ldap-sync/
Email ThisBlogThis!Share to XShare to Facebook
Posted in | No comments
Newer Post Older Post Home

0 comments:

Post a Comment

Subscribe to: Post Comments (Atom)

Popular Posts

  • ​Modern browsers for modern applications
    ​The web has evolved in the last ten years, from simple text pages to rich, interactive applications including video and voice. Unfortunatel...
  • Help customers find their way with new Google Maps gadget
    Last week, I looked up directions to the hotel in Sacramento that I had booked for the Fourth of July weekend. As I had never been to that p...
  • Students and others find what they're looking for with Google Search
    When you think about all that a university has to offer, you probably think of classes, curriculum, and alumni activities. But universities ...
  • Google Services for Websites expands to include Google Site Search
    Google Site Search has now been included into an expanded version of the access provider program. The program was created last year for the...
  • Connecting Google Apps Education Edition with Blackboard
    Editor's note: George Kroner is a Developer Relations Engineer for Blackboard, a company that focuses on transforming and improving the ...
  • Spelling Suggestions and Thumbnail View in Google Docs
    Google Docs lets you create, store, and share work files with teammates and other colleagues. Today we're making it easier for you to s...
  • Collaborating with Google Apps and Socialwok
    Editor's Note: Ming Yong is co-founder of Socialwok, a a feed-based group collaboration application for enterprises that integrates with...
  • Google Apps update: Email migration, shared address book, and a cool video
    Posted by Ryan Pollock, Product Marketing As Vikaram noted on the Official Google Blog , today was a big day for Google Apps. We introduced ...
  • 30,000 Valeo employees put Google Apps to work
    Tens of millions of people around the world have transitioned from software-based email and personal productivity tools to powerful web-base...
  • Google Apps on Campus: Getting Things Done in '08
    2008 was an action-packed year for Google Apps for Education . We grew by 300% since last year, released two new products: Google Sites and...

Categories

  • admin
  • Android
  • cloud computing
  • developers
  • earth and maps
  • education
  • enterprise
  • events
  • gmail
  • gonegoogle
  • Google Apps
  • Google Apps Blog
  • Google Calendar
  • google commerce search
  • google docs
  • Google Email Security and Archiving
  • Google Enterprise Search
  • Google I/O
  • Google Maps
  • google message security
  • Google Search Appliance
  • Google Site Search
  • google sites
  • Google spreadsheets
  • Google Video
  • Google Wave
  • government
  • guest post
  • hints and tips
  • innovation
  • IT
  • K-12
  • large business
  • mashups
  • medium business
  • migration
  • mobile
  • new features
  • non-profit
  • partners
  • Postini
  • productivity
  • small business
  • spam and security trends
  • success story
  • switch
  • university
  • viewpoint
  • webinar
  • webmaster

Blog Archive

  • ►  2010 (14)
    • ►  January (14)
  • ►  2009 (178)
    • ►  December (11)
    • ►  November (12)
    • ►  October (15)
    • ►  September (19)
    • ►  August (18)
    • ►  July (19)
    • ►  June (13)
    • ►  May (15)
    • ►  April (15)
    • ►  March (14)
    • ►  February (13)
    • ►  January (14)
  • ►  2008 (78)
    • ►  December (9)
    • ►  November (16)
    • ►  October (8)
    • ►  September (8)
    • ►  August (3)
    • ►  July (4)
    • ►  June (4)
    • ►  May (5)
    • ►  April (5)
    • ►  March (7)
    • ►  February (5)
    • ►  January (4)
  • ▼  2007 (79)
    • ►  December (6)
    • ►  November (7)
    • ►  October (6)
    • ►  September (8)
    • ►  August (4)
    • ▼  July (9)
      • How can you take your Enterprise Search to the nex...
      • Google Apps migration tools
      • Customer reactions to the latest Google Earth Ente...
      • Don't believe everything you read
      • From the PM to you in under an hour
      • Our Directory is Your Directory
      • Making website search work for you
      • Easier IT for nonprofits
      • Secure innovation - Postini joins the Google team
    • ►  June (6)
    • ►  May (10)
    • ►  April (7)
    • ►  March (7)
    • ►  February (1)
    • ►  January (8)
  • ►  2006 (76)
    • ►  December (4)
    • ►  November (6)
    • ►  October (13)
    • ►  September (10)
    • ►  August (6)
    • ►  July (9)
    • ►  June (6)
    • ►  May (7)
    • ►  April (3)
    • ►  March (3)
    • ►  February (7)
    • ►  January (2)
Powered by Blogger.

About Me

Unknown
View my complete profile